.VirtualBox folder in different versions of VBox
I installed VBox OSE from source in the 2.6.32-020632rc5-generic kernel on Ubuntu 9.10. I plan on installing the non-ose version when the kernel is fully released or a more stable 2.6.32.x version is released. Does anyone know if it will be a problem to use the same .VirtualBox folder and thus keep all my vdi's? Thanks!
Re: .VirtualBox folder in different versions of VBox
Your VDI's should remain untouched in either case.

Re: .VirtualBox folder in different versions of VBox
Well the folder named .VirtualBox won't be touched and I understand that, but would there be any read or permission problems with a non-ose version of VirtualBox reading from a folder created by the OSE version? I just wonder if I install the non-ose version of VirtualBox and try to start up my vm's if it's going to say something is preventing it from starting the vm's.

Re: .VirtualBox folder in different versions of VBox
The folder is in your home folder, so if there would be any read or write problems, it would be a very bad thing. That means that some third party (like, maybe root or some malicious program) changed them, but that's very unlikely to happen.
